电机控制专用国产32位单片机MM32SPIN360C
灵动微电子是本土领先的通用32位MCU产品及解决方案供应商,提供MM32 MCU基于Arm Cortex-M系列内核200多个型号,MM32 MCU被广泛应用于工业、电机、家电、消费玩具、手机平板配件、医疗、交通出行、显示及交互等领域。灵动可以为客户提供从优异芯片产品到核心算法和从完备参考设计方案到整机开发的全方位支持。 国产32位单片机MM32SPIN360C拥有M0内核的高性能32位微控制器,5V输出的LDO稳压器、三组具备有自举二极管的N通道半桥栅极驱动器。MCU最高工作频率可达96MHz,并内置SRAM高速存储器,增强丰富型I/O端口和外设连接到外部总线。采用QFN48封装形式。本产品包含2个12位的ADC、3个比较器、3个运算放大器、1个16位通用定时器、1个32位通用定时器、3个16位基本定时器、2个16位高级定时器。还包含标准的通信接口:1个I2C接口、1个SPI接口和2个UART接口。国产32位MCU MM32SPIN360丰富的外设配置适合于三相永磁无刷电机和电动工具等应用场合。MM32SPIN360C引脚封装
MM32SPIN360C引脚封装
MM32SPIN360C特征 •内核与系统–32位ARMCortex-M0处理器内核–最高工作频率可达96MHz–单指令周期32位硬件乘法器–硬件除法器(32Bit)–硬件开方(32bit)•存储器–高达128K字节的闪存程序存储器–高达12K字节的SRAM–Bootloader支持片内Flash、在线系统编程(ISP)•时钟、复位和电源管理–2.0V~5.5V供电–上电/断电复位(POR/PDR)、可编程电压监测器(PVD)–外部2~24MHz高速晶体振荡器–内嵌经出厂调校的48MHz高速振荡器•低功耗–睡眠、停机和待机模式 在电动工具的方案中,有集成高速算法内建运放与集成预驱的MM32SPIN360C微控制器启动转矩大,还有超高的转速与快速启动,把无刷马达电动工具寿命长和性能好及体积小等优势发挥到最好的状态。灵动MM32SPIN360C在今年8月的CITE大会上还获得了创新技术奖。通过这些明星产品,灵动完成了非常多的终端应用布局和成功的开发案例。灵动微总代理英尚微电子提供开发板和例程以及产品应用解决方案等。
工程师,还有6个引脚封装的单片机?涨知识了
工程师,在开发设计电路项目,一般都是围绕微处理器这个中心进行,根据项目的功能需求,设计微处理器的外围电路;微处理器按照类型区分,包含
MCU单片机,如ST意法的STM32F103RCT6单片机;DSP处理器,如TI德州仪器的TMS320C6652;FPGA处理器,如Xilinx赛灵思的XA7A50T;CPU处理器,如Intel英特尔的I5处理器;其中,对于一些功能较为简单,不需要大量的数据运算,工程师优先选用的微处理器会是MCU单片机。这是为什么呢?
第一,开发设计简单,无论是硬件电路设计还是软件代码设计,工程师只需依据MCU单片机公司提供的参考设计例程,进行二次开发基本上就能完成项目的电路方案开发;
第二,成本低廉,由于8位单片机与32位单片机被大量的应用在不同产品中,出货量非常庞大,直接的结果是单片机价格的直线下降;
第三,大中院校的电子教材,基本都是以单片机的开发案例为主,为日后参加工作的学生培养了使用单片机的习惯;
单片机电路项目
是的,没错!单片机应用非常广,也非常受工程师的欢迎!
在设计项目的过程中,工程师会面临一个问题---如何选择项目匹配的单片机型号?因为单片机不仅品牌多,而且数量多、功能多还型号多。
以单片机的封装为例来区分,工程师常见的封装类型如,SOP8、MSOP10、SOP14、SOP16、TSSOP20、QFN24、QFN32、LQFP44、LQFP48、LAFP64等等
可是,工程师是否接触过还有6引脚封装的单片机吗?一个单片机只有6个引脚,而且还包括2个电源引脚。可能这是全世界最小引脚数量的单片机了,仅仅只有6个引脚,其封装为SOT23-6。
SOT23-6封装单片机
那么这个只有6个引脚封装的单片机,有什么特色呢?芯片哥以上海晟矽微的MC30P6250为例进行详细的说明
MC30P6250单片机引脚定义
在了解一个新型号的单片机之前,首先需要熟知这个型号MC30P6250单片机的引脚定义
MC30P6250单片机
Pin 1引脚:SDI & PWM1B & P11SDI:编程数据信号输入引脚,作为编程口,也可作为SPI通信输入引脚;
PWM1B:单片机内部定时器PWM信号的输出引脚;
P11:单片机的普通IO引脚,内部集成上拉与下拉电阻,可编程;
Pin 2引脚:GNDGND:单片机的电源的引脚,作为0V的参考点;
Pin 3引脚:SDO & EVN0 & P14SDO:编程数据信号的输出引脚,作为编程口,也可作为SPI通信输出引脚;
EVN0:单片机内部比较器正端输入引脚;
P14:单片机的普通IO引脚,内部集成上拉电阻,可编程;
Pin 4引脚:P13 & CMPN & RST & VPPP13:单片机的普通IO引脚,内部集成上拉电阻,可编程;
CMPN:单片机内部比较器负端输入引脚,与EVN0共同构成单片机的比较器输入检测功能;
RST:单片机的外部复位输入引脚;
VPP:单片机的编程高压输入引脚;
Pin 5引脚:VDDVDD:单片机的电源输入引脚;
Pin 6引脚:P12 & TC0 & BUZ1 & CMPO & SCKP12:单片机的普通IO引脚,内部集成上拉与下拉电阻,可编程;
TC0:单片机内部定时器的外部计数输入引脚;
BUZ1:有源蜂鸣器驱动输出引脚;
CMPO:单片机内部比较器的输出引脚;
SCK:编程时钟信号,作为编程口,也可作为SPI通信的时钟引脚;
MC30P6250单片机功能特点
在基本了解这个型号MC30P6250的单片机引脚定义后,它的功能特点可以归纳为
它是一个OTP类型的单片机,存储空间大小只有1K*14 bit,有且只能编写一次;单片机的内核属于8位CPU,工程师想不到吧,呵呵~~~内置高频RC振荡器,最大可支持16MHz的主频,是不是有点小惊喜,意不意外~~~PWM波输出功能;比较器功能;SPI串口通信功能;工作电压范围0~6.0V,支持3.3V与5.0V系统;其中集成了内部比较器,是这个6引脚封装的单片机最大的特色;当然其他型号的SOT23-6封装的单片机,也可以集成类似触摸按键功能、ADC采集功能等等;
另外一个特点是单片机的IO引脚输出输入电流能力,输出电流可达20mA,输入电流可达30mA;要超出一些常规的单片机IO引脚特性。
IO引脚输出电流能力大,其最大的优势是可以直接驱动一些小型负载,比如LED灯,不再需要其他功率放大电路了。
MC30P6250单片机项目应用
初步掌握SOT23-6封装的单片机MC30P6250特性后,工程师就可以使用其开发设计电路项目了。尤其是一些功能简单的小型电器产品项目,比如
智能化妆镜,只需两个按键检测和两个IO输出就可以满足;
智能感应水龙头,只需三个IO引脚就可以满足;
智能小便池,只需四个IO引脚就可以满足;
智能门禁,只需三个IO引脚就可以满足;
开发这些功能的项目,虽然SOT23-6封装的单片机能胜任,但设计它的软件,芯片哥建议工程师优先选用汇编语言,因为汇编语言占用的存储空间相比较C语言编写的程序要小一些;
使用SOT23-6封装的单片机,在软件开发上使用汇编语言,可能会有些不便,但它的另一个特点是价格便宜,毕竟只有6个引脚的单片机,应该是属于全球最小封装的单片机吧。MC30P6250单片机参考价为 0.5~0.6RMB/PCS。
尾声
MC30P6250型号的单片机,虽然只有6个引脚,但它的功能和其他普通的8位单片机一样,区别在于内部集成的外设资源相对较少,除去两个电源引脚VDD和GND之外,只有其他四个可以定义的IO引脚功能;
在硬件电路应用和软件开发上,与其他形式封装的单片机,没有任何本质的区别。
本文由【芯片哥】原创撰写,一个只谈电子元器件与芯片的工程师,喜欢就关注芯片哥,和芯片哥一起加油吧~~~ #芯片# #单片机# #电子元器件#
相关问答
单片机32 位优缺点?单片机32位优点:1.从内部的硬件到软件有一套完整的按位操作系统,称作位处理器,处理对象不是字或字节而是位。不但能对片内某些特殊功能寄存器的某位进行处理...
32 位 单片机 swd下载模式用哪些引脚?STM32单片机采用SWD模式下载程序时,占用单片机的swclk和swdio引脚,其中,swclk是同步时钟信号,swdio是双向数据信号。对于不同的stm32单片机,这两个引脚的位...
有没有 32 个引脚的 单片机 ?有32个引脚的单片机有很多系列,有20脚的,有32脚的,有48脚的,有64脚的,有100脚的,有144脚的,还有208脚的。主要看芯片资料说明,还有根据自己的需要选择对...
esp 32 是什么 单片机 ?ESP32是由乐鑫发布的新一代WiFi芯片,是ESP8266的升级版,准确来说是ESP8266的完整版,双核,wifi,蓝牙,低功耗,更多管脚外设。ESP32特性ESP32双核低功耗...ES...
单片机 9EB2H各 脚 功能?1.VCC(40):电源+5V。2.VSS(20):接地,也就是GND。3.XTL1(19)和XTL2(18):振荡电路。单片机是一种时序电路,必须有脉冲信号才能工作,在它的内部...1.VC...
32 位在 单片机 里什么意思?指数据总线32位,从4位,8位,16位,32位,到64位,位数越大,处理速度越快指数据总线32位,从4位,8位,16位,32位,到64位,位数越大,处理速度越快
stm- 32单片机 是做什么的?stm-32单片机是做无人机制作。现在无人机主流的微控制器所用的就是stm32控制器。简单仪器仪表。stm32可以用作简单示波器、频率计,对采集的数字信号进行处理...
32单片机 能承受多少电流?答:32单片机能承受电流:STM32一般引脚最高耐压到4V,而且这个耐压值还受限于引脚的灌电流,鉴于楼主使用的是AD输入引脚,如果参考电压为3.3V,输入电压大于3....
32单片机 编程都代表什么?32单片机编程都代表语言编程。用C语言编程的话,没什么不同不管是8位的32位的,硬件结构不同,功能也会相差很大,主要区别就体现在特殊功能寄存器上,用C语言...
STM 32 是什么啊,是 32 位的 单片机 吗?stm32是一种32位的单片机。单片机是嵌入式系统中最常用的核心部件,stm32本质上也是一种单片机。从事嵌入式方面工作,如果有一定的基础,可以从STM32单片机入...